Pros

-Requires employees to be in the office 2 days a week, in the Boston office. This is still an industry best when compared to the insurance carriers -Some very talented and knowledgeable coworkers -Good career opportunities are available for college graduates or for those with under 5 years of experience; limited opportunities for advancement for more experienced individuals due to a flat structure

Cons

-The workload for most, including both sales and client service operations [CSO], is exhausting. If work/life balance is important, there are better companies to work for -Hi amount of pressure to document everything and produce Core360 documents so that clients do not sue AJG. Work is done out of fear, rather than wanting to help clients -The office's health is tied to the life sciences industry and the number of IPOs, which has been poor the last 2 years -Benefits, ESPP discounts, and equity grants are below average when compared to the rest of the insurance industry

Pros

Great work-life balance as a remote employee. Management is approachable and genuinely willing to help when it comes to workload — you never feel like you're on your own.

Cons

Mentorship is largely self-driven. if you don't seek it out yourself, it won't come to you. Systems and internal processes can be slow and tedious, which adds friction to an already fast-paced workload. Compensation does not reflect the complexity or volume of work expected. High performers who are ready for the next step would benefit from clearer, more proactive promotion paths. When that structure is missing, talented people disengage quietly long before they ever leave.
